As published in the Foundation’s Report for 1933–34:
SCHNEIDER, ISIDOR: Appointed for creative writing, abroad; tenure, twelve months from January 1, 1935.
Born August 25, 1896, in Galicia. Education: College of the City of New York, 1915–19.
Publications: Doctor Transit, 1925; Temptation of Anthony and Other Poems, 1927. Articles and poetry in New Republic, Nation, Scribner’s Magazine, Forum, Broom, transition, This Quarter, Poetry, Reedy’s Mirror, Saturday Review of Literature, New Masses, Menorah Journal, Dial. Contributor to The American Caravan.
